The trees of Grizzly Hills blew gently in the evening breeze. That was all that most heard in the area, but for one it was the least of all sounds. The trees literally whispered amongst themselves. The muffled rocks mumbled to each other, deep below the ground. All of this and more was heard by the druid, Alaredor. For years he had studied the druidic arts first mastered by the greatest of the druids: Malfurion Stormrage, brother of the great betrayer Illidan and lover of Sister Tyrande Whisperwind. A greater Shan'do there had never been, aside from the demigod Cenarius, who had been struck dead by the hording orcs during the third war. Though Alaredor had not been directly trained by Shan'do Stormrage, his training was greatly influenced by the ancient druid.
His mere presence in the forest of Grizzly Hills could be taken as a display of disrespect toward both the late Cenarius and Malfurion. Most of his kind spent their days walking the Emerald Dream, a realm where one could view the world as it would be without the influences of the various races of Azeroth. For Alaredor, time in the Emerald Dream was time wasted. The real world needed him and his druid powers more than the alternate realm did. His refusal to live his days in The Dream made Alaredor a bit of an outcast amongst the other druids. Alaredor managed to avoid his most vocal critics, as they rarely returned to the physical realm.

Alaredor sat silently outside of a small lodge meditating for nearly an hour before he sensed his approaching companion. Instantly his feeling of balance was completely thrown into disarray. He had prepared himself for this, as he knew about his companion's condition, but the preparation wasn't enough. A sense of disgust flooded the druid's mind, and he briefly accepted the feeling, but quickly reminded himself to ignore it. The one coming had the taint of the Lich King and his scourge, though milder, but Alaredor knew better. The man had once been a powerful warrior for the Lich King, but after a great conflict he broke free from his master and rejoined the world.
